Vehicle inverters are power supply products operating in high-current, high-frequency environments, resulting in a relatively high potential failure rate. Therefore, consumers must be cautious when purchasing one:

 

1. Besides price, the main considerations when choosing a vehicle power supply are its input voltage requirements and output power. Furthermore, since the power requirements of various electrical appliances differ significantly, the choice should be based on actual usage needs, prioritizing sufficiency.

 

2. Different types of electrical appliances require different vehicle power supplies. For everyday resistive appliances, square wave, modified wave, and sine wave inverters are all suitable. For inductive appliances, a sine wave inverter is necessary.

 

3. Square wave/modified wave inverters cannot power inductive or capacitive loads, cannot power air conditioners or refrigerators, and are unlikely to provide power for high-quality audio and television systems. Strictly speaking, square wave/modified wave inverters can affect the lifespan of electrical appliances, problems that do not occur when using a sine wave inverter.

 

4. The cigarette lighter fuse in a typical passenger car is 10A or 15A (10A fuses are mostly for older models or imported vehicles). This means that the car inverter that can be used in a typical passenger car is 120W or 180W. If you need a high-power inverter (over 180W or 200W), be sure to check if the packaging includes battery clamps. High-power inverters without battery clamps will have limitations in use in passenger cars.

 

5. Most car power supplies have a fuse at the cigarette lighter socket. Automotive Supplies Network reminds you to always check that this fuse is incompatible with the cigarette lighter fuse (theoretically, it should be less than or equal to the cigarette lighter fuse). This ensures the cigarette lighter fuse will function correctly; otherwise, it will blow, causing unnecessary trouble.
